58-5-128. Merger or consolidation of stock insurers.

A domestic stock insurer may merge or consolidate with other domestic or foreign insurers authorized to transact insurance in this state, by complying with the applicable statutes of this state that govern the merger or consolidation of corporations formed for profit but subject to the provisions of §§ 58-5-129 to 58-5-133 , inclusive.
